Control system for work machine, work machine, and management system for work machine
A control system includes: a detector detecting a position of a work machine running on a running path; a non-contact sensor detecting an object at a side of the running path; a generator generating map data of a work site based on detection data from the detector and the non-contact sensor; a first storage storing past map data generated in the generator based on the detection data from the detector and the non-contact sensor acquired in a predetermined period in a past; a second storage storing current map data generated in the generator based on the detection data from the detector and the non-contact sensor; a first calculator calculating integrated map data by integrating the past map data and the current map data; and a second calculator by matching the integrated map data and the detection data from the non-contact sensor, calculates the position of the work machine.
MANAGEMENT SYSTEM FOR WORK MACHINE, WORK MACHINE, AND MANAGEMENT DEVICE FOR WORK MACHINE
A management system 1 for a work machine includes: a plurality of dump trucks 2 each creating a map information piece DTI of a sectioned region DT around the own vehicle; and a management device 10 that manages map information pieces DTI of a plurality of sectioned regions DT created by the plurality of dump trucks 2 and transmits, to each of the dump trucks 2, a map information piece DTI of a sectioned region DT where each of the dump trucks 2 exists and a map information piece DTI of a sectioned region DT adjacent to the sectioned region DT where each of the dump trucks 2 exists on the basis of information related to a position of each of the dump trucks 2.
Registration calculation of three-dimensional scanner data performed between scans based on measurements by two-dimensional scanner
A method for measuring and registering three-dimensional (3D) coordinates by measuring 3D coordinates with a 3D scanner in a first registration position, measuring two-dimensional (2D) coordinates with a 2D scanner while moving from the first registration position to a second registration position, measuring 3D coordinates with the 3D scanner at the second registration position, and determining a correspondence among targets in the first and second registration positions while moving between the second registration position and a third registration position.
Navigation device and method
Embodiments of the present invention relate to a device including a module (490) which is operative in a low-power state of the device (200). The module (490) is arranged to determine whether a traffic situation on a route has more than a predetermined affect on the route, and to cause the navigation device (200) to output a notification in response thereto which alerts the user of the device to the traffic situation despite the device being in the low-power state.
APPARATUS AND ASSOCIATED METHOD FOR USE IN UPDATING MAP DATA
An apparatus comprising a processor and memory including computer program code, the memory and computer program code configured to, with the processor, enable the apparatus at least to: use a classification model to identify one or more anomalies between a monitored trajectory of a vehicle through a road network and predefined map data for the road network which are likely caused by errors in the predefined map data; and provide details of the one or more identified anomalies for use in obtaining additional data for the specific locations on the road network corresponding to the one or more identified anomalies in order to correct the errors in the predefined map data.
Generalising topographical map data
Aspects described herein improve upon systems and methods for generalizing topographical map data relating to the road network for use at different scale levels. Existing systems collapse the two carriageways of a dual carriageway to a single centerline representing the dual carriageway by tracking along one way sections of carriageway and generating pairs of carriageways for collapse, but fall short of being able to compute complicated intersections. Further, existing methods place heavy demands on processing power and are not suitable for change only refreshes. Aspects described herein use graph theory to create a tracked network of stroke type objects representing the length of single carriageway sections of dual carriageways, and then successfully pairs them such that they can be collapsed to a center line and connected to the road network. The process reduces computation time, thereby speeding the rendering process for map imagery.
Identifying a change in a home environment
A system and computer implemented method for detecting a change in a home environment for a visually impaired user is disclosed. The method may include monitoring the home environment using a set of sensors configured to collect environment data for a set of areas of the home environment. The method may also include detecting an environmental change in an area of the home environment. The method may also include providing, in response to a triggering event, a notification of the environmental change.
MET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R UPDATING ROAD MAP GEOMETRY BASED ON RECEIVED PROBE DATA
A method is provided for generating and revising map geometry based on a received image and probe data. A method may include: receiving probe data from a first period of time, where the probe data from a first period of time is from a plurality of probes within a predefined geographic region; generating a first image of the predefined geographic region based on the probe data from the first period of time; receiving probe data from a second period of time different from the first period of time, where the probe data from the second period of time is from a plurality of probes within the predefined geographic region; generating a second image based on the probe data from the second period of time; comparing the first image to the second image; and generating a revised route geometry based on changes detected between the first image and the second image.

MAP GENERATING DEVICE, MAP GENERATING METHOD, AND PROGRAM RECORDING MEDIUM
An identification unit obtains a plurality of photographic images including two or more markers. The makers are placed on a different object, respectively. The identification unit identifies, from the plurality of photographic images thus obtained, three-dimensional positions of the two or more markers. A generating unit transforms coordinate system of the plurality of photographic images into a common coordinate system. Relative positions of the two or more markers based on a specific location are indicated in the common coordinate system. The generating unit generates map data which associates the positions of the two or more markers.
